commit 9a868f634349e62922c226834aa23e3d1329ae7f upstream.

This commit adds security feature flags to reflect the settings we
receive from firmware regarding Spectre/Meltdown mitigations.

The feature names reflect the names we are given by firmware on bare
metal machines. See the hostboot source for details.

Arguably these could be firmware features, but that then requires them
to be read early in boot so they're available prior to asm feature
patching, but we don't actually want to use them for patching. We may
also want to dynamically update them in future, which would be
incompatible with the way firmware features work (at the moment at
least). So for now just make them separate flags.

commit d6fbe1c55c55c6937cbea3531af7da84ab7473c3 upstream.

Add a definition for cpu_show_spectre_v2() to override the generic
version. This has several permuations, though in practice some may not
occur we cater for any combination.

The most verbose is:

  Mitigation: Indirect branch serialisation (kernel only), Indirect
  branch cache disabled, ori31 speculation barrier enabled

We don't treat the ori31 speculation barrier as a mitigation on its
own, because it has to be *used* by code in order to be a mitigation
and we don't know if userspace is doing that. So if that's all we see
we say:

  Vulnerable, ori31 speculation barrier enabled

commit 0f9bdfe3c77091e8704d2e510eb7c2c2c6cde524 upstream.

The H_CPU_BEHAV_* flags should be checked for in the 'behaviour' field
of 'struct h_cpu_char_result' -- 'character' is for H_CPU_CHAR_*
flags.

Found by playing around with QEMU's implementation of the hypercall:

  H_CPU_CHAR=0xf000000000000000
  H_CPU_BEHAV=0x0000000000000000

  This clears H_CPU_BEHAV_FAVOUR_SECURITY and H_CPU_BEHAV_L1D_FLUSH_PR
  so pseries_setup_rfi_flush() disables 'rfi_flush'; and it also
  clears H_CPU_CHAR_L1D_THREAD_PRIV flag. So there is no RFI flush
  mitigation at all for cpu_show_meltdown() to report; but currently
  it does:

  Original kernel:

    # cat /sys/devices/system/cpu/vulnerabilities/meltdown
    Mitigation: RFI Flush

  Patched kernel:

    # cat /sys/devices/system/cpu/vulnerabilities/meltdown
    Not affected

  H_CPU_CHAR=0x0000000000000000
  H_CPU_BEHAV=0xf000000000000000

  This sets H_CPU_BEHAV_BNDS_CHK_SPEC_BAR so cpu_show_spectre_v1() should
  report vulnerable; but currently it doesn't:

  Original kernel:

    # cat /sys/devices/system/cpu/vulnerabilities/spectre_v1
    Not affected

  Patched kernel:

    # cat /sys/devices/system/cpu/vulnerabilities/spectre_v1
    Vulnerable

commit a048a07d7f4535baa4cbad6bc024f175317ab938 upstream.

On some CPUs we can prevent a vulnerability related to store-to-load
forwarding by preventing store forwarding between privilege domains,
by inserting a barrier in kernel entry and exit paths.

This is known to be the case on at least Power7, Power8 and Power9
powerpc CPUs.

Barriers must be inserted generally before the first load after moving
to a higher privilege, and after the last store before moving to a
lower privilege, HV and PR privilege transitions must be protected.

Barriers are added as patch sections, with all kernel/hypervisor entry
points patched, and the exit points to lower privilge levels patched
similarly to the RFI flush patching.

Firmware advertisement is not implemented yet, so CPU flush types
are hard coded.
